The Book of Enoch
A foundational apocalyptic text from the 2nd century BCE, quoted in the New Testament (Jude 14-15). Explores the fallen angels, the Watchers, and the coming judgment. Translated by R.H. Charles.
The Book of Jubilees
“Little Genesis” — retells the book of Genesis from creation to Moses with angelic chronology and the division of times. Translated by R.H. Charles.
1-3 Meqabyan (Ethiopian Maccabees)
Three books unique to the Ethiopian canon, covering Maccabean-era history from an Ethiopian perspective. Not to be confused with 1-4 Maccabees found in the Greek Septuagint.
The Shepherd of Hermas
An early Christian apocalyptic work from the 1st-2nd century AD. Highly regarded by the early Church fathers. Contains visions, mandates, and parables on repentance and Christian living.
4 Baruch (Paralipomena of Jeremiah)
Also known as the “Rest of the Words of Baruch,” this text recounts the prophet Jeremiah’s final days and the exile of the Ark of the Covenant.
